The Acropora spp. (Cream-Common) is a tiny, tank-bred SPS coral prized for its delicate creamy hues and intricate branching structure. As a member of the Acropora genus, it is well-suited to experienced reef keepers who can provide the stable, high-quality conditions necessary for its health and growth.
Lighting: This coral thrives under strong, full-spectrum lighting such as metal halide, T5, or high-output LED systems. Adequate lighting is essential to support its symbiotic zooxanthellae and maintain vibrant coloration.
Water Flow: Moderate to high water flow is recommended to ensure effective gas exchange, nutrient delivery, and to prevent detritus accumulation around the coral’s delicate branches.
Placement: Position the coral in the upper to middle regions of the aquarium where lighting and flow conditions are optimal. Ensure sufficient spacing from neighbouring corals to prevent aggressive interactions and allow room for growth.
Care Level: Due to its sensitivity, this Acropora species requires stable water parameters, including consistent calcium, alkalinity, and magnesium levels, as well as low nutrient concentrations.
Compatibility: Reef safe with adequate spacing; avoid placing near aggressive corals that may cause tissue damage.
Regular monitoring and maintenance will help ensure this tiny Acropora spp. thrives, adding a stunning natural element to your SPS coral collection.
